From 19577fb53b541df6dbbb7436f137fe28c1708432 Mon Sep 17 00:00:00 2001 From: lukibeg Date: Thu, 20 Nov 2025 14:14:37 -0300 Subject: [PATCH] refactor: Reestrutura pastas. --- app/Livewire/Admin/{ => Client}/AddClient.php | 4 ++-- .../Admin/{ => Client}/DeleteClient.php | 4 ++-- .../Admin/{ => Client}/EditClient.php | 4 ++-- app/Livewire/Admin/ShowUsers.php | 13 ------------ app/Livewire/Admin/{ => User}/CreateUser.php | 4 ++-- app/Livewire/Admin/User/EditUser.php | 13 ++++++++++++ app/Livewire/{Admin => }/ShowClient.php | 7 +++---- app/Livewire/ShowUsers.php | 21 +++++++++++++++++++ 8 files changed, 45 insertions(+), 25 deletions(-) rename app/Livewire/Admin/{ => Client}/AddClient.php (92%) rename app/Livewire/Admin/{ => Client}/DeleteClient.php (87%) rename app/Livewire/Admin/{ => Client}/EditClient.php (93%) delete mode 100644 app/Livewire/Admin/ShowUsers.php rename app/Livewire/Admin/{ => User}/CreateUser.php (94%) create mode 100644 app/Livewire/Admin/User/EditUser.php rename app/Livewire/{Admin => }/ShowClient.php (76%) create mode 100644 app/Livewire/ShowUsers.php diff --git a/app/Livewire/Admin/AddClient.php b/app/Livewire/Admin/Client/AddClient.php similarity index 92% rename from app/Livewire/Admin/AddClient.php rename to app/Livewire/Admin/Client/AddClient.php index 7295d54..4ef7c0e 100644 --- a/app/Livewire/Admin/AddClient.php +++ b/app/Livewire/Admin/Client/AddClient.php @@ -1,6 +1,6 @@ delete(); } - $this->dispatch('clientDeleted'); + $this->dispatch('client-deleted'); // (Opcional) Envia uma notificação de sucesso $this->dispatch('notify', message: 'Cliente excluído com sucesso!'); } diff --git a/app/Livewire/Admin/EditClient.php b/app/Livewire/Admin/Client/EditClient.php similarity index 93% rename from app/Livewire/Admin/EditClient.php rename to app/Livewire/Admin/Client/EditClient.php index 963a8bd..af9d250 100644 --- a/app/Livewire/Admin/EditClient.php +++ b/app/Livewire/Admin/Client/EditClient.php @@ -1,6 +1,6 @@ showUsers(); + return view('livewire.admin.show-users', ['users' => $users]); + } + public function render() + { + return view('livewire.admin.show-users'); + } +}